Understanding Difference Between Ground Beam And Plinth Beam: A Complete Overview
Ground beams are laid below ground level to connect footing structures. Primary Function Plinth beams support wall loads and prevent settlement cracks, while ground beams connect footings and provide foundational support. Plinth Beam is a beam in a frame structure provided at ground level. Also known as tie beam because it binds the column. It therefore reduces column length and minimum size. It may not carry any slide load and is designed to carry its own weight and construction load above the plinth beam.
